--TEST--
Segfault and assertion failure with refcounted props and arrays
--INI--
soap.wsdl_cache_enabled=0
--EXTENSIONS--
soap
--FILE--
<?php
class TestSoapClient extends SoapClient {
function __doRequest($request, $location, $action, $version, $one_way = false, ?string $uriParserClass = null): string {
return <<<EOF
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<SOAP-ENV:Envelope xmlns:SOAP-ENV="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/" xmlns:ns1="http://schemas.nothing.com" xmlns:xsd="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ema" x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ance" xmlns:SOAP-ENC="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/encoding/" SOAP-ENV:encodingStyle="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/encoding/"><SOAP-ENV:Body>
<ns1:dotest2Response><res xsi:type="SOAP-ENC:Struct">
<a xsi:type="xsd:string">Hello</a>
<b xsi:type="xsd:string">World</b>
</res>
</ns1:dotest2Response></SOAP-ENV:Body></SOAP-ENV:Envelope>
EOF;
}
}
trait A {
public $a = [self::class . 'a'];
public $b = self::class . 'b';
}
class DummyClass {
use A;
}
$client = new TestSoapClient(__DIR__."/../classmap.wsdl", ['classmap' => ['Struct' => 'DummyClass']]);
var_dump($client->dotest2("???"));
?>
--EXPECTF--
object(DummyClass)#%d (%d) {
["a"]=>
array(2) {
[0]=>
string(11) "DummyClassa"
[1]=>
string(5) "Hello"
}
["b"]=>
array(2) {
[0]=>
string(11) "DummyClassb"
[1]=>
string(5) "World"
}
}
